Captured this female Sat morning in the backyard.
Canon 40D
Canon 400mm F/5.6
manual mode
1/500
F/6.3
ISO 100
on tripod
center focus point
curves, smart sharpen, minor cropping, little saturation
Please comment pros and cons. Thanks

Nice image of the bird. The crop is unusual and needs to have less negative space around the bird I think. The out of focus dark lines coming in from the top are not helping, I would suggest a tighter crop, a vertical closer to the bird to get rid of more of the bg. The catchlight looks a bit odd to me.
